Spring
zhangjianshan007
仗剑天涯,从你的摘要开始
展开
-
SpringAOP+注解+RocketMQ实现分布式日志记录
why 利用AOP可以对业务逻辑的各个部分进行隔离,从而使得业务逻辑各部分之间的耦合度降低,提高程序的可重用性,同时提高了开发的效率。通过消息中间件无需每个服务都实现日志的相关操作. what 添加aop和rocketMQ <!--aop--> <dependency> <groupId>org.springframework.boot</groupId> <art原创 2020-12-08 11:58:13 · 1097 阅读 · 0 评论 -
Spring构造注入不需要加@Autowired?
在Spring4.x中增加了新的特性: 如果类只提供了一个带参数的构造方法,则不需要对对其内部的属性写@Autowired注解,Spring会自动为你注入属性; 配合lombok的@RequiredArgsConstructor使用体验很好; @RequiredArgsConstructor会将类的每一个final字段或者non-null字段生成一个构造方法 例子 @RestController @RequiredArgsConstructor @RequestMapping(Constant.M.原创 2020-12-01 17:59:12 · 1506 阅读 · 1 评论